- The distance between Royal Oak, Md, Usa and Abilene, Tx, Usa is approximately 2,252 km or 1,400 mi.
- To reach Royal Oak, Md in this distance one would set out from Abilene, Tx bearing 64.4°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Royal Oak, Md bearing 78.4° or ENE .
- Both have a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Royal Oak, Md is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Abilene, Tx is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 4.4 °C (7.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.2 °C (2.2°F) more in Royal Oak, Md.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 499.1 mm (19.6 in) more which is equivalent to 499.1 l/m² (12.25 US gal/ft²) or 4,991,000 l/ha (533,571 US gal/ac) more. About 1 4/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.6° lower in Royal Oak, Md than in Abilene, Tx.
